Description

REQUIREMENTS:


  • Education: Bachelor’s degree highly preferred.

EXPERIENCE:

  • 5–10 years in food & beverage manufacturing quality leadership, with hands-on experience in SPC, DOE, TQM, TPM, Six Sigma, etc.
  • 3–5+ years of experience managing and developing teams of 20+ technical employees.
  • Experience with new product, material, and process introductions.

KNOWLEDGE:

  • Deep understanding of GMP, HACCP, FSMA, SQF, Food Defense, and QMS principles.
  • Proven track record of building effective Quality Plans and achieving KPI targets.
  • Experience with SAP preferred; proficiency in Microsoft Office required.
  • Strong CAPA and A3 problem-solving experience.

SKILLS:

  • Strong written and verbal communication across departments.
  • High attention to detail, strong multitasking ability, and self-motivation.
  • Ability to lead teams of 10+ employees and work flexible hours as needed.
  • Occasional travel required.
Responsibilities
  • Lead and develop a team of direct reports across Quality, Sanitation, and Batching functions.
  • Oversee the collection, analysis, and reporting of performance and product conformance data; communicate quality status and priorities to production leadership.
  • Manage plant Quality personnel (QC specialists, technicians, and sanitation staff) to drive data-informed decision-making and continuous process improvements.
  • Support new product, material, and supplier qualifications in coordination with R&D and Procurement.
  • Drive performance improvements tied to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), dashboards, and quality scorecards for cost, delivery, and quality.
  • Partner with production and maintenance teams to promote strong quality awareness and capability throughout the plant.
  • Oversee certification processes, including documentation, product specs, audits, and reporting systems.
  • Provide timely resolutions to production-related quality issues and product dispositions.
  • Develop tools to collect, trend, and analyze production quality data.
  • Ensure compliance with food safety and regulatory standards (FSMA, FDA GMP, GFSI).
  • Prepare for and resolve issues related to third-party audits.
  • Conduct regular facility inspections to ensure adherence to company and regulatory policies.
  • Submit monthly quality reports to Corporate Quality and Continuous Improvement teams.
  • Actively participate in enterprise-wide Quality, Food Safety (QFS), and Continuous Improvement initiatives.
